A vital situation for optical aspects to operate with infrared gentle is usually that transparency (i.e., propagation with minimal absorption and scattering losses) is received for optical materials – particularly for elements like lenses and prisms, exactly where propagation lengths is usually sizeable, but frequently also for dielectric coatings.

The spots in between these bands can't be applied on account of absorption by different molecules within the Earth’s atmosphere. On the other hand, these in-amongst bands are usable if the system is at high altitude or in Room.

Herein, we primarily take into account two Houses: ligand extend frequency as well as their absorption depth. Take read more the ligand CO one example is all over again. The frequency shift in the carbonyl peaks while in the IR mostly is dependent upon the bonding method from the CO (terminal or bridging) and electron density to the metallic.

Within an alternate process, this technique is together a similar strains of the nujol mull except as opposed to the suspending medium being mineral oil, the suspending medium is a salt. The reliable is floor into a fantastic powder having an agate mortar and pestle by having an quantity of the suspending salt.
